Kovoqli varaki somsa - pumpkin samsa
Ingredients:
650 g or 4 3/4 cups flour
400 g (14-15 oz) pumpkin
2 egg
160 g (3-4 oz) onions
150 g (5 oz) mutton fat
70 g (2 1/2 oz) margarine
sugar, salt and pepper to taste

Directions:
For the filling, combine diced pumpkin with chopped onions, fat, salt, sugar and spices. To make dough, add warm water, egg and salt to sifted flour, let stand for 30-40 minutes. Roll out dough into 3-4 mm (1/8 in) layer and grease surface with melted margarine. Roll up the dough tightly forming a log, and cool 5-6 hours. Cut log into 50 g (2 oz) pices and place on their flat sides. Roll out into small flat rounds. Place a spoonful of filling in the center, pinch edges around the pumpkin forming a square pastry, and completely enclose the filling. Bake 20-25 minutes in an oven.
